Yesterday, I went to the wanglong job fair with several students in the class and thought there were not many people. At the very beginning, they were full and even the corridor was full. At the beginning, it was a presentation. The vice president was really funny. It was embarrassing to ask a girl at the beginning. Haha, but the boss left the girl with a face. But in the end, no specific salary level is specified. After that, the technical team will take the test. C ++ game development positions. When I first got a question, I felt that it was still the foundation of the test. However, the basics do not necessarily mean that you can answer well. There are many pointer questions, so I can draw a conclusion, the basic knowledge must not be lost. The test is usually not noticed by programming. Let's briefly review the pen questions of yesterday.
1. Select
This section mainly describes the array declaration, concurrency, differences between processes and programs, database views, and switch branch statements.
Ii. Q &
1. How can I prevent repeated header file references? Why?
2. What is the difference between pointer and reference?
3. How does Winsock establish a connection?
4. What is STL? What is the function? Write out the three STL containers that you normally use and briefly describe them?
Iii. Correction
The specific question cannot be recalled, but can only be omitted
1. It is not difficult to declare and define pointers.
2. getmemory (char * P) is actually a topic on Dr. Lin Rui's book, so Dr. Lin Rui's book is really the materials for a lot of corporate written test interviews. Be sure to chew on this book.
3. Various sizeof values. It's not that easy to get all the correct answers to a series of concepts.
Iv. algorithm questions
Implement data structure definitions and functions by yourself. Two ordered linked lists A and B. Merge the two of them into a linked list. After the merge, the linked list is still ordered. This question should be the most basic algorithm in the data structure, but it was not completely developed at that time. Unfortunately. You need to work hard.
V. programming questions
It is not difficult to change a process-oriented question to an object-oriented style, but it is not easy to design well.
From the above questions, we can see that in addition to some super-large companies that focus on algorithm testing, most companies mainly test the C ++ language basics, so the basics still need to be consolidated. Wait for the message. Amen!